Comments:
Grade 3 follicular lymphomas (FLs) have greater than 15 centroblasts/hpf. Thus, their spectrum ranges from 16 centroblasts/hpf to cases in which majority of the cells in the neoplastic follicles are centroblasts. Grade 3 FLs are subdivided into 3A (centrocytes still present and admixed with centroblasts) and 3B (solid sheets of centroblasts). The image shows an example of Grade 3A follicular lymphoma. Centroblasts with large round vesicular nuclei and prominent nucleoli make up the dominant cell type; however, centrocytes are still present. Mitotic activity is increased in Grade 3 FLs and their clinical behavior is aggressive.
